Transaction dd789425c23b1449e8683ed584c4cc1a09bb0aec045ea3e5df2337fe513ceebe

1 Input
2 Outputs
  • dd789425c23b1449e8683ed584c4cc1a09bb0aec045ea3e5df2337fe513ceebe:0
  • value  1427223
    address  3E1cWVsKLq2yCzJYMhKUEhUKaRvG3dznKd
  • dd789425c23b1449e8683ed584c4cc1a09bb0aec045ea3e5df2337fe513ceebe:1
  • value  225470
    address  14fhrve2orKKtdZ9VNoRCMXZzJ1dbzMywJ